Ticket: Config drift on the Pellwright transcode farm

While debugging stuck 4K jobs last week, we noticed the worker nodes in the Brindle cluster no longer match the checked-in config. Someone hand-edited encoder presets and GPU slot counts directly on the hosts, so deploys now behave differently per node. We need to reconcile before the weekly sync and re-enable enforcement. For reference, the intended baseline configuration is as follows.

deployment values, fahap-hahaf:
[casdor]
port = 9200
region = south-2
host = casdor.qirvanworks.corp
timeout_ms = 3000
retries = 4

Q: How does GlyphGuard flag typo-squatting packages?

A: GlyphGuard compares new package names against our Tessera registry using edit distance and homoglyph checks. Anything scoring above threshold is quarantined pending review. Support should not release quarantined packages manually — escalate to the registry team instead. False-positive rates and current threshold settings are documented on the internal scanner page:

runbook for badug-kadup: https://confluence.zemvarlabs.internal/projects/browse/display/projects/bd1b

Handover Note — Quarterly Cash-Flow Forecast

To the board: as I transfer duties to Director Samwell Crane, I confirm the Q2 forecast for Lorring Fabrics is complete. Inflows assume the Pelwick contract settles on schedule; outflows include the Dareholt lease uplift. Sensitivity ranges are conservative and documented in the model appendix. Samwell has reviewed every assumption with me line by line. The confidential planning note for the board follows immediately below.

management briefing: Only 34 of the 227 pilot accounts renewed Julath, so a churn review is set for December 28. Jorwynox Foods is in early talks to buy Silirix Freight for about $241.8 million.

## Ticket: Signature verification failure — FeedWarden validator

FeedWarden's podcast feed validator began rejecting signed manifests from the Castwick ingest pipeline at 04:12 this morning. Verification fails with a digest mismatch on every feed, including known-good fixtures, which suggests the trust store was updated out of band rather than feed tampering. No unauthorized access indicators so far. For your review, the currently deployed verification key is reproduced below.

deploy key for fahap-yawep: bky9_Sz7nfBZP5